Precise structural information on the Mg1-xAlxB2 superconductors in the vicinity of xapproximate to0.5 is derived from high-resolution synchrotron x-ray powder diffraction measurements. We find that a hexagonal superstructure, accompanied by doubling of the c axis, ordering of Mg and Al in alternating layers, and a shift of the B layers towards Al by similar to0.12 Angstrom, is formed. The unusually large width of the (00 1/2) superlattice peak implies the presence of microstrain broadening, arising from anisotropic stacking of Al and Mg layers and/or structural modulations within the ab plane. The ordered phase survives only over a limited range of compositions away from the optimum x=0.5 doping level.
